main.go embeds frontend/dist, so lint, test and bindings-check all fail
on a fresh clone until pnpm build has run. Invisible locally because
anyone who has started the app has a dist/ lying around, and the
container prototype missed it because both job scripts shared one
mounted directory, so job 1 consumed a dist/ that job 2's dev-headless
had built on an earlier run.

A coding agent could develop this repo's Go packages and could not
develop the application: every path to running YellowJacket ended in a
blocking GTK window, so 265 bound methods, 46 events, 33 component
directories and 13 stores had exactly one form of verification
available — `tsc --noEmit`.

The unlock is that `wails dev`'s dev server on :34115 serves the real
frontend with the real generated bindings against the same Go backend a
desktop window attaches to, so a plain Chromium under Xvfb gets a fully
functional app. Four test tiers now exist, cheapest first:

- `make ui-test` — 313 Vitest tests in a real browser in ~2 s, no app,
  no backend, no display. Works because `frontend/wailsjs/` is a pure
  passthrough to `window.go`/`window.runtime`, so faking just those two
  globals runs the real bindings and the real store code.
- `make test` — services in-process, asserting on the payload the
  frontend would receive, via a new `events.Emit` wrapper.
- `make dev-headless` + `playwright-cli` — the real app, driven
  interactively, with an event bridge on `window.__yjEvents` and a
  dev-only control surface at `/__test/`.
- `make e2e` — 19 of those flows frozen as Playwright specs.

`events.Emit(ctx, …)` replaces all 35 direct `runtime.EventsEmit` call
sites: wails' `getEvents` `log.Fatalf`s on any context without its
runtime, so those paths could not run under test and a background
worker could take the app down. Four packages had each hand-rolled the
same guard; nine more guarded on `ctx != nil`, which does not help.
`TestNoDirectRuntimeEmits` fails the build on a new one.

Fixtures are generated, not committed (`make testdata`), and seeds are
built by *running the app* — never by hand-writing config and DB rows,
which would be a second description of a valid YJ_HOME.

`.gitea/workflows/ci.yml` is the first workflow here that tests
anything; the other three only package, so `gitea_ci` reported only
packaging jobs and misled anyone asking whether a push was healthy.
Both jobs were prototyped to green in a bare ubuntu:24.04 container
before the YAML was written, which immediately caught `make lint`
linting three configurations that nothing builds: all three passes
omitted `webkit2_41`, so wails resolved webkit2gtk-4.0 — which Arch
still ships and Ubuntu 24.04 dropped.

Operational instructions live in `.pi/skills/yellowjacket-dev/`,
measured discoveries in `.planning/NOTES.md`, and architecture in
`CLAUDE.md` — split by tense, not by topic, because a topical split
gives every new fact two plausible homes. `make skill-check` fails a
commit if the skill cites a make target that does not exist.

Autotag: detect "junk drawer" folders with no artist/album consensus
and split them into synthetic per-cluster groups instead of forcing
one match on an unrelated pile of tracks; repair tagging_items rows
left behind by a prior scan orphan-cleanup gap.

Explore: fix an exact artist-name search being drowned out by its own
catalog entries in intent-prior scoring, and prune stale in_library
bookkeeping left behind when a referenced library row is deleted.

Download: fix a multi-library regression where every import failed
with "no library root configured" — the importer resolved the
library root from a legacy single-library config field that nothing
populates in the current multi-library model. It now resolves the
destination library per-request from the request's own library_id.
Also widen the Soulseek search window (12s -> 20s), measured against
real request history to be missing available peers on live queries.

Add a central job registry that library scans and search index builds
report into, so background work is visible instead of buried in the
settings page.

- backend/jobs: registry with per-job ring-buffer logs, capability-driven
  controls, and one coalesced JobsChanged snapshot at 4Hz
- pause survives restart via a job_state table; a paused scan is adopted
  back on launch and skipped by the soft scan
- top-bar indicator, popover, details drawer and a Jobs page replacing
  the config page's scan UI; per-library start/stop retained
- scan timing breakdown moves into the job log, Full rescan to the Jobs
  page; delete the orphaned library-manager component

Also add cmd/indexbuild and cmd/indexexport so the explore index can be
built once centrally rather than by every install, which today streams
~205GB from the ListenBrainz spark dump on first run. indexbuild picks
build/refresh/rebuild from index state; the Gitea workflow runs it on
push, weekly, or manually and publishes only when content changed.

fresh-install no longer defaults YJ_HOME under /tmp: it is tmpfs on most
distros, and the import needs ~6GB of real disk.
